Hoping you can help me with what i think is a simple problem but cannot =
solve and it revolves around me not being able to compile any C++ code =
with performer. i even tried simple.C and the provided makefiles but to =
no avail. Heres my system configuration:
Redhat 7.2
gcc 2.96 and gcc3 3.02
g++ 2.96 and g++3 3.02
Performer 2.52 for gcc3 (also have 2.51 compiled for gcc3 but not =
installed)
so i run make simple and heres the error that i get:
[root++at++bg3ntl C++]# make simple
make[1]: Entering directory `/usr/share/Performer/src/pguide/libpf/C++'
Making DSO version of simple.dso
make[2]: Entering directory =
`/usr/share/Performer/src/pguide/libpf/C++/OPT.I386'
g++3 -O3 -ffast-math -mpentiumpro -MD -fwritable-strings =
-fno-for-scope -I/usr/include -I/usr/include/g++-3 -o simple.dsocmd =
simple.o -L/usr/lib -L/usr/lib/libpfdb -L/lib -lpfdu -lpfutil -lpfdu =
-lpfui -lpf -L/usr/X11R6/lib -lGLU -lGL -lXext -lXm -lXt -lXp -lXpm =
-lXmu -lX11 -lm -ldl
simple.o: In function `main':
simple.o(.text+0x89): undefined reference to `pfUpdatable::operator =
new(unsigned int)'
simple.o(.text+0x93): undefined reference to `pfScene::pfScene(void)'
simple.o(.text+0xa2): undefined reference to =
`pfBuffer::pf_indexUpdatable(pfUpdatable const *) const'
simple.o(.text+0xbe): undefined reference to `pfUpdatable::operator =
new(unsigned int)'
simple.o(.text+0xcc): undefined reference to =
`pfLightSource::pfLightSource(void)'
simple.o(.text+0xde): undefined reference to =
`pfBuffer::pf_indexUpdatable(pfUpdatable const *) const'
simple.o(.text+0x106): undefined reference to `pfUpdatable::operator =
new(unsigned int)'
simple.o(.text+0x114): undefined reference to =
`pfPipeWindow::pfPipeWindow(pfPipe *)'
it just appears to a problem that it isnt linking properly and / or =
doesnt recognise the header files included. it seems so simple but i've =
spent days trying to get it to work and nothing does. what am i doing =
wrong ? i'm sure i have everything i need installed, the only exception =
being some library called libGLw, which i thought was only required for =
motif so i removed it from the makedefs file. do i need this lib ? i =
dont see how that would solve my performer linking probs though.
if i write just plain C code, then i can compile fine but i need to =
write for C++ (client requirement).
im pretty desperate here, please see if you can help me and if you =
require any additional information (ie lib versions) please ask me.
